The benefits of mineral fiber acoustic ceilings extend beyond sound absorption. They are non-combustible and help improve fire safety within a building, as they can slow the spread of flames. Moreover, many mineral fiber products are designed to resist moisture and mold growth, making them ideal for areas like kitchens and bathrooms, where moisture is prevalent.

Ceiling access covers are removable panels installed in ceilings to provide access to building systems such as electrical wiring, plumbing, and HVAC systems. They are typically made from durable materials like metal or high-quality plastic and can be designed to blend seamlessly with the ceiling or to stand out as a functional feature. The right choice of an access cover can enhance the aesthetic appeal of a space while allowing for easy maintenance and inspection of vital building systems.
For most ceiling applications, the 24” x 24” panel is a popular choice, as it provides ample space for accessing larger systems while maintaining structural integrity. However, custom sizes are also available for unique installations, thus accommodating specific project needs.

Maintaining the integrity of a ceiling can often require significant effort, but laminated ceiling tiles offer durability that simplifies this process. The laminate layer provides a protective barrier against stains, moisture, and fading from sunlight, making them suitable for areas that experience high humidity or other challenging conditions. Cleaning laminated tiles is also straightforward, typically requiring only a damp cloth and mild detergent, thus ensuring that they remain visually appealing with minimal effort.

A grid ceiling consists of a framework of metal grid tracks that hold ceiling tiles or panels. This system creates a void between the ceiling and the structural roof, which can be utilized for various purposes, including housing ductwork, plumbing, and electrical wiring. Grid ceilings provide a functional barrier that conceals structural components while offering an opportunity for aesthetic enhancement.

A fire rated ceiling access door is a specifically designed entryway that is installed in ceilings to allow access to spaces such as HVAC systems, plumbing, and electrical wiring. What sets these doors apart is their ability to withstand high temperatures for a specified duration, usually rated in hours (e.g., one hour, two hours). This is crucial in commercial and industrial buildings where fire safety regulations are strict, and any breach in fire barriers must be effectively managed.
